15ab502cbSMasahiro Yamada#include "tegra30.dtsi" 25ab502cbSMasahiro Yamada 35ab502cbSMasahiro Yamada/ { 45ab502cbSMasahiro Yamada model = "Avionic Design Tamonten NG"; 55ab502cbSMasahiro Yamada compatible = "ad,tamonten-ng", "nvidia,tegra30"; 65ab502cbSMasahiro Yamada 75ab502cbSMasahiro Yamada memory { 85ab502cbSMasahiro Yamada reg = <0x80000000 0x40000000>; 95ab502cbSMasahiro Yamada }; 105ab502cbSMasahiro Yamada 11c3691392SSimon Glass chosen { 12c3691392SSimon Glass stdout-path = &uartd; 13c3691392SSimon Glass }; 14c3691392SSimon Glass 155ab502cbSMasahiro Yamada aliases { 165ab502cbSMasahiro Yamada i2c0 = "/i2c@7000c000"; 175ab502cbSMasahiro Yamada i2c1 = "/i2c@7000c700"; 185ab502cbSMasahiro Yamada i2c2 = "/i2c@7000c400"; 195ab502cbSMasahiro Yamada i2c3 = "/i2c@7000c500"; 205ab502cbSMasahiro Yamada i2c4 = "/i2c@7000d000"; 2167748a73SStephen Warren mmc0 = "/sdhci@78000600"; 2267748a73SStephen Warren mmc1 = "/sdhci@78000400"; 2367748a73SStephen Warren mmc2 = "/sdhci@78000000"; 245ab502cbSMasahiro Yamada usb0 = "/usb@7d008000"; 255ab502cbSMasahiro Yamada }; 265ab502cbSMasahiro Yamada 275ab502cbSMasahiro Yamada /* GEN1 */ 285ab502cbSMasahiro Yamada i2c@7000c000 { 295ab502cbSMasahiro Yamada status = "okay"; 305ab502cbSMasahiro Yamada clock-frequency = <100000>; 315ab502cbSMasahiro Yamada }; 325ab502cbSMasahiro Yamada 335ab502cbSMasahiro Yamada /* GEN2 */ 345ab502cbSMasahiro Yamada i2c@7000c400 { 355ab502cbSMasahiro Yamada clock-frequency = <100000>; 365ab502cbSMasahiro Yamada }; 375ab502cbSMasahiro Yamada 385ab502cbSMasahiro Yamada /* CAM */ 395ab502cbSMasahiro Yamada i2c@7000c500 { 405ab502cbSMasahiro Yamada status = "okay"; 415ab502cbSMasahiro Yamada clock-frequency = <100000>; 425ab502cbSMasahiro Yamada }; 435ab502cbSMasahiro Yamada 445ab502cbSMasahiro Yamada /* DDC */ 455ab502cbSMasahiro Yamada i2c@7000c700 { 465ab502cbSMasahiro Yamada status = "okay"; 475ab502cbSMasahiro Yamada clock-frequency = <100000>; 485ab502cbSMasahiro Yamada }; 495ab502cbSMasahiro Yamada 505ab502cbSMasahiro Yamada /* PWR */ 515ab502cbSMasahiro Yamada i2c@7000d000 { 525ab502cbSMasahiro Yamada status = "okay"; 535ab502cbSMasahiro Yamada clock-frequency = <100000>; 545ab502cbSMasahiro Yamada }; 555ab502cbSMasahiro Yamada 565ab502cbSMasahiro Yamada /* SD slot on the base board */ 575ab502cbSMasahiro Yamada sdhci@78000400 { 582b2b50bcSSimon Glass cd-gpios = <&gpio TEGRA_GPIO(I, 5) GPIO_ACTIVE_LOW>; 592b2b50bcSSimon Glass wp-gpios = <&gpio TEGRA_GPIO(I, 3) GPIO_ACTIVE_HIGH>; 605ab502cbSMasahiro Yamada bus-width = <4>; 615ab502cbSMasahiro Yamada }; 625ab502cbSMasahiro Yamada 635ab502cbSMasahiro Yamada /* EMMC on the COM module */ 645ab502cbSMasahiro Yamada sdhci@78000600 { 655ab502cbSMasahiro Yamada status = "okay"; 665ab502cbSMasahiro Yamada bus-width = <8>; 679a06a1a3STom Warren non-removable; 685ab502cbSMasahiro Yamada }; 695ab502cbSMasahiro Yamada 705ab502cbSMasahiro Yamada usb@7d008000 { 715ab502cbSMasahiro Yamada status = "okay"; 725ab502cbSMasahiro Yamada }; 735ab502cbSMasahiro Yamada 74*ce2f2d2aSStephen Warren clocks { 75*ce2f2d2aSStephen Warren compatible = "simple-bus"; 76*ce2f2d2aSStephen Warren #address-cells = <1>; 77*ce2f2d2aSStephen Warren #size-cells = <0>; 78*ce2f2d2aSStephen Warren 79*ce2f2d2aSStephen Warren clk32k_in: clk@0 { 80*ce2f2d2aSStephen Warren compatible = "fixed-clock"; 81*ce2f2d2aSStephen Warren reg=<0>; 82*ce2f2d2aSStephen Warren #clock-cells = <0>; 83*ce2f2d2aSStephen Warren clock-frequency = <32768>; 84*ce2f2d2aSStephen Warren }; 85*ce2f2d2aSStephen Warren }; 865ab502cbSMasahiro Yamada}; 87